The size of Chelmer is approximately 1.8 square kilometres. It has 8 parks covering nearly 10.6% of total area. The population of Chelmer in 2016 was 2998 people. By 2021 the population was 3325 showing a population growth of 10.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Chelmer is 10-19 years. Households in Chelmer are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Chelmer work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 82.00% of the homes in Chelmer were owner-occupied compared with 78.30% in 2016.
